I have a premium 360 with HDDVD ad on. I have about 6 gigs left on my HDD. Okay this is my two option I have been thinking. Option #1 is to buy the 120gig HDD, VGA cable (supposably will up-convert regular DVD's). Total cost is about $225. Or option #2 is to buy the Elite 360. Total cost is about $500. I know some will say go cheaper route, I am also looking for the best way to up-convert regular DVD's and for the best experience. I have a 40 inch LCD HDTV that is 720p/1080i. I would like to see what other people think. Any information will be appreciated and taken into consideration. I would personally go with option #1 because the Elite is only cosmetically different with basically a couple throw ins. Unless your 360 is acting up or you just have to have a black one, there is no real upgrade and you can purchase that stuff outside of the bundle and save yourself some money for something else. ;)
